Willard Simpson, 1120 E. Mulkey, work on a lathe during an open house at the Panther Boys Club, while Mrs. J. W. Hughes, 1316 Travis, and Executive Secretary Ira DeShazo, watch. Boys getting a tip on shop work are, left to right, Calvin Ray Russell, 1227 E. Harvey; Jimmy Meyers, 2524 Willing, and Lyle Waddell, 1619 Austin.
